Bennington is a white (non-hispanic) neighborhood in Vancouver with 2 census tracts and a population of 8,432 residents. The neighborhood's pop-weighted eviction-risk score of 5.1/10 (Moderate tier) blends state law, county-level fil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ty. 54% of renters here pay at least 30% of household income on rent, and 23% are severely cost-burdened (≥50% of income). Average gross rent of $2,023/month sits 19% higher than the Vancouver citywide average ($1,702).

Eviction filings · Princeton Eviction Lab
Court-record eviction history in Bennington
Aggregated across 2 validated constituent tracts. Filing rate is filings per 100 renter households, pop-weighted.
Historic baseline (2000–2018)
55Total filings (sum)
1.00%Avg annual filing rate
3.2%Peak year (2013)
0.56%Latest filed (2018)
